The Potter's Hands is a four-week course designed to provide youth with the opportunity to explore the exciting world of pottery and create meaningful pieces. Our Intro to Pottery & Pottery Design course offers a hands-on experience for youth interested in fun, interactive craftsmanship. Instructor will teach students how to make specific clay creations. They will also have the opportunity for free play with clay, to let their imaginations roam. Students can expect to pick up their fired work 2-3 weeks after the 4 week rotation.
